London Diamond Syndicate was formed in 1890 to

Explanation:
A syndicate in this field is a cooperative formed by merchants to coordinate trading activities. In 1890, London Diamond Syndicate brought diamond merchants together to unite their buying and selling of rough diamonds, creating a shared marketplace and standard practices. That description fits best because it emphasizes the collective nature and the specific product involved—rough diamonds—rather than a government body or a later marketing effort.
